What is Market Share Growth Due to Strategic Initiatives?
The increase in market share directly attributable to strategic projects and initiatives, indicating market competitiveness.




Market Share Growth Due to Strategic Initiatives serves as a critical performance indicator for organizations aiming to enhance their competitive positioning.

It directly influences revenue growth, customer acquisition, and brand loyalty.

By tracking this KPI, executives gain valuable insights into the effectiveness of strategic initiatives and their impact on market dynamics.

A robust market share growth strategy can lead to improved financial health and operational efficiency.

Companies that excel in this area often outperform their peers, achieving superior ROI metrics and driving sustainable business outcomes.

Market Share Growth Due to Strategic Initiatives Interpretation

High values indicate successful strategic initiatives that resonate with target markets, leading to increased customer engagement and loyalty. Conversely, low values may signal ineffective strategies or misalignment with market needs. Ideal targets vary by industry, but a consistent upward trend is crucial for sustained growth.

  • Above 10% – Strong market presence; effective strategies
  • 5% to 10% – Moderate growth; review initiatives
  • Below 5% – Weak performance; reassess strategies

Common Pitfalls

Many organizations underestimate the importance of aligning strategic initiatives with market demands, leading to stagnation in market share growth.

  • Failing to conduct thorough market research can result in misguided strategies. Without understanding customer needs and preferences, initiatives may miss the mark and fail to resonate with the target audience.
  • Neglecting to monitor competitive actions can leave a company vulnerable. Competitors may capitalize on market gaps or introduce innovations that outpace existing offerings, eroding market share.
  • Overlooking internal alignment among departments can create friction. When marketing, sales, and product teams operate in silos, strategic initiatives may lack cohesion and effectiveness.
  • Ignoring customer feedback can stifle growth opportunities. Organizations that do not actively seek and act on customer insights risk alienating their base and missing critical improvement areas.

Improvement Levers

Enhancing market share growth requires a proactive approach to strategy and execution, focusing on customer engagement and competitive positioning.

  • Invest in comprehensive market research to identify emerging trends and customer preferences. This data-driven decision-making enables organizations to tailor initiatives that resonate with target segments.
  • Foster cross-departmental collaboration to ensure cohesive strategy execution. Regular alignment meetings can help synchronize efforts and enhance operational efficiency across teams.
  • Implement agile methodologies to adapt quickly to market changes. Flexibility in strategy allows organizations to pivot based on real-time insights, improving responsiveness to customer needs.
  • Enhance customer engagement through personalized marketing campaigns. Tailored messaging and offers can significantly boost customer loyalty and drive repeat business, positively impacting market share.

What is the standard formula?
(Post-Initiative Market Share - Pre-Initiative Market Share) / Pre-Initiative Market Share * 100

FAQs

What factors influence market share growth?

Several factors contribute to market share growth, including product innovation, customer engagement, and competitive positioning. Understanding market dynamics and aligning strategies accordingly is crucial for success.

How often should market share be analyzed?

Regular analysis is essential, ideally on a quarterly basis. This frequency allows organizations to track trends, assess the impact of strategic initiatives, and make timely adjustments.

What role does customer feedback play?

Customer feedback is vital for identifying areas of improvement and innovation. Actively seeking insights helps organizations align their offerings with market demands, driving growth.

Can market share growth impact financial performance?

Yes, increased market share often correlates with improved financial performance. A larger market presence can lead to higher revenues, better economies of scale, and enhanced brand loyalty.

What are the risks of focusing solely on market share?

Overemphasizing market share can lead to neglecting profitability and customer satisfaction. A balanced approach is necessary to ensure long-term sustainability and financial health.

How can technology aid in tracking market share?

Technology facilitates real-time data collection and analysis, enabling organizations to track market share effectively. Business intelligence tools can provide actionable insights for strategic decision-making.
